Abstract

From the study of the city of Ribeirão Preto, we propose the analysis of daily mobility and accessibility characteristics to discuss the emergence of the fragmented city in Brazil. Therefore, articulating the singular and the universal, we established the theoretical bases to show how mobility takes place in the city, demonstrating its urban structure and its role in the Brazilian urban network. The database of the Cadastro Nacional de Pessoas Jurídicas (CNPJ) was important in shaping the urban multicentrality, a methodological element to which other equally important ones were added, such as interviews and surveys applied according to preestablished criteria, and data on the characteristics of the surroundings of the properties and the average income of families, valuing the mapping of the elements studied. The results approached from the voice of the interviewees, show the dynamics of urban mobility in Ribeirão Preto in the different parts that structure the city. In the conclusions, we show how the combination of the different elements studied reflects the urban dynamics in terms of socio-spatial differentiation.
